How much do Pharmacists make in Virginia?
The median Pharmacists in Virginia earns $144,060 per year (BLS May 2025), about $69.26 per hour.
What is that after taxes?
$144,060 gross in Virginia keeps $102,262 after federal income tax ($23,308), FICA ($11,021) and state income tax ($7,469) — $8,522 per month, a 71% keep-rate.
How does Virginia compare to the national median for Pharmacists?
The Virginia median is $3,150 above the national median of $140,910.
Which state pays Pharmacists the most?
Alaska has the highest median gross for Pharmacists at $167,310 — but compare take-home, not gross: state taxes change the order.
